Join the Naval Nuclear Laboratory as an Electrician This position is located at the Bettis Atomic Power Laboratory supporting the Bettis Facilities, Infrastructure & Engineering team.
About the role:
Lead, direct and perform work on new and existing electrical systems.
Perform maintenance on low voltage and high voltage systems.
Ability to perform asbestos removal / abatement on existing wiring systems.
Perform utility scanning in accordance with local procedures and document findings for upcoming excavations work on site.
Respond to trouble calls related to immediate electrical system issues to help maintain continuity of operations.
Identify and develop improvements to existing facilities or methods of operation.
Required Combination of Knowledge and Skill
High school or vocational school graduate or the equivalent with the ability to read, write and perform general mathematics of the variety usually learned in a high school or vocational school course.
AND
Completion of a state accredited skilled trades program resulting in an educational degree or equivalent in the field of this position with 4 years of experience
OR
Completion of a state approved certified apprenticeship program resulting in qualification of Journeyman or equivalent in the field of this position with 4 years of experience
Preferred Skills
Preferred to possess a Journeyman qualification from a recognized trade union in the field of this position.
